|
@@ -117,7 +117,7 @@ public class OrderServiceImpl extends ServiceImpl<OrderMapper, Order> implements
|
|
.between(null != orderRequest.getStartMoney() && null != orderRequest.getEndMoney(),
|
|
.between(null != orderRequest.getStartMoney() && null != orderRequest.getEndMoney(),
|
|
Order::getMoney,orderRequest.getStartMoney(),orderRequest.getEndMoney())
|
|
Order::getMoney,orderRequest.getStartMoney(),orderRequest.getEndMoney())
|
|
.between(null != orderRequest.getStartTime() && null != orderRequest.getEndTime(),
|
|
.between(null != orderRequest.getStartTime() && null != orderRequest.getEndTime(),
|
|
- Order::getCreateTime,orderRequest.getStartMoney(),orderRequest.getEndTime())
|
|
|
|
|
|
+ Order::getCreateTime,orderRequest.getStartTime(),orderRequest.getEndTime())
|
|
.eq(null != orderRequest.getOrderFlag(),Order::getOrderFlag,orderRequest.getOrderFlag());
|
|
.eq(null != orderRequest.getOrderFlag(),Order::getOrderFlag,orderRequest.getOrderFlag());
|
|
page = this.page(page, queryWrapper);
|
|
page = this.page(page, queryWrapper);
|
|
return new CommonPage<>(page.getRecords(),page.getTotal(),page.getCurrent(),page.getSize());
|
|
return new CommonPage<>(page.getRecords(),page.getTotal(),page.getCurrent(),page.getSize());
|
|
@@ -135,7 +135,7 @@ public class OrderServiceImpl extends ServiceImpl<OrderMapper, Order> implements
|
|
String orderNumber = TopApi.getOrderNumber();
|
|
String orderNumber = TopApi.getOrderNumber();
|
|
order.setOrderNumber(orderNumber);
|
|
order.setOrderNumber(orderNumber);
|
|
TreeMap<String, String> params = TopApi.generateScanPayApiParam(order.getOrderNumber(),
|
|
TreeMap<String, String> params = TopApi.generateScanPayApiParam(order.getOrderNumber(),
|
|
- new Double(Arith.mul(order.getMoney(),100)).intValue(), null,
|
|
|
|
|
|
+ new Double(Arith.mul(order.getMoney().doubleValue(),100)).intValue(), null,
|
|
null,null,null,null,null,null);
|
|
null,null,null,null,null,null);
|
|
baseMapper.insert(order);
|
|
baseMapper.insert(order);
|
|
//记录调用日志
|
|
//记录调用日志
|
|
@@ -192,7 +192,7 @@ public class OrderServiceImpl extends ServiceImpl<OrderMapper, Order> implements
|
|
try {
|
|
try {
|
|
ChargeVO chargeVo = new ChargeVO();
|
|
ChargeVO chargeVo = new ChargeVO();
|
|
chargeVo.setSeq(order.getId());
|
|
chargeVo.setSeq(order.getId());
|
|
- chargeVo.setAmt(order.getMoney());
|
|
|
|
|
|
+ chargeVo.setAmt(order.getMoney().doubleValue());
|
|
chargeVo.setCard("h");
|
|
chargeVo.setCard("h");
|
|
chargeVo.setMob(order.getOrderNumber());
|
|
chargeVo.setMob(order.getOrderNumber());
|
|
chargeVo.setName("test");
|
|
chargeVo.setName("test");
|
|
@@ -375,7 +375,7 @@ public class OrderServiceImpl extends ServiceImpl<OrderMapper, Order> implements
|
|
if ("W06".equals(order.getTopPayType())){
|
|
if ("W06".equals(order.getTopPayType())){
|
|
appId = TopApi.WX_APP_ID;
|
|
appId = TopApi.WX_APP_ID;
|
|
}
|
|
}
|
|
- TreeMap<String, String> params = TopApi.generateUnifyParam(orderNumber,new Double(Arith.mul(order.getMoney(),100)).intValue(),
|
|
|
|
|
|
+ TreeMap<String, String> params = TopApi.generateUnifyParam(orderNumber,new Double(Arith.mul(order.getMoney().doubleValue(),100)).intValue(),
|
|
null, null,
|
|
null, null,
|
|
null,null,null,order.getTopPayType(),null,appId,
|
|
null,null,null,order.getTopPayType(),null,appId,
|
|
null,null,null,null);
|
|
null,null,null,null);
|